Compound: Sodium 4-butyl-3,5-dioxo-1,2-diphenylpyrazolidin-4-ide( cas:129-18-0 ) is researched.Application of 129-18-0.Pawelczyk, Ewaryst; Wachowiak, Roman published the article 《Kinetics of drug decomposition. VII. Kinetics of sodium phenylbutazone hydrolysis》 about this compound( cas:129-18-0 ) in Dissertationes Pharmaceuticae et Pharmacologicae. The decomposition rate of 0.00303M Na phenylbutazone (I) in aqueous buffer under N was 1st order. The rate was independent of kind and concentration of buffer, its ionic strength, and hydroxyl ion activity. Storage of a 20% aqueous solution of I at 20° produces a decomposition loss of 10% after 1.047 years. Concentrations of I were determined spectrophotometrically using measurements at 235 and 264 nm.
